How to fill out credit limit application

How to fill out a credit limit application:
01
Gather the necessary documents and information: Before starting the application, make sure you have all the required documents and information handy. This may include identification, proof of income, bank statements, and any other financial documentation that the application requires.
02
Understand the terms and conditions: It's important to read and fully understand the terms and conditions of the credit limit application. Familiarize yourself with the interest rates, fees, and other details associated with the credit limit.
03
Provide accurate personal and financial information: Fill out the application form accurately, ensuring that all personal and financial information is correct. Any discrepancies or incorrect information may result in delays or even rejection of the application.
04
Specify the desired credit limit: Clearly indicate the credit limit you are requesting on the application. Consider your financial situation and credit needs when determining the appropriate limit.
05
Consent to a credit check: Most credit limit applications require a credit check to assess your creditworthiness. Consent to the credit check as required, as it is a standard procedure in the application process.
06
Submit the application: Once you have filled out the application form, double-check the information and ensure all required fields are completed. Then, submit the application through the designated method, whether it is an online submission, mailing, or in-person submission.
Who needs a credit limit application?
01
Individuals seeking additional financial flexibility: Those who want the ability to make larger purchases or have access to additional funds during emergencies may need a credit limit application. It allows them to use credit within a specified limit set by the lender.
02
Small businesses and entrepreneurs: Small businesses often require credit to manage cash flow, purchase inventory, or invest in growth. A credit limit application provides them access to funds to support their business operations.
03
Frequent travelers: Individuals who frequently travel may benefit from having a credit limit application. It can help them manage their finances while on the go, pay for travel expenses, and provide additional purchasing power while abroad.
04
Students: College students and young adults who are starting to build their credit history may find a credit limit application useful. It allows them to establish credit and learn responsible credit management, which can be valuable in the long term.
05
Those in need of emergency funds: Having a credit limit application can provide a safety net for unexpected expenses or financial emergencies. It allows individuals to access funds quickly without the need for collateral.
06
Individuals looking to improve their credit score: Responsible use of credit through a credit limit application can help individuals improve their credit score over time. Timely payments and keeping credit utilization low can positively impact their credit history.
